Refrigerators that have seen better days

GE released a retrospective this week that brought back memories. It displayed the trends in appliance colors during the last 100 years.

I currently have a black side-by-side refrigerator.

But I seriously cannot remember the colors of the many refrigerators of my past. Can you?

As a child, I seem to remember a harvest gold fridge and perhaps a brown of some sort.

In various apartments I lived in during and after college I had at least one or two white fridges.

And I have coveted some very pretty refrigerators with glass doors. They make the food look so formal, like a still life.
